here is the easiest one \[ f(x) = -5; x = -3, -2, -1, 0, 1, 2, 3\] \(f(-3)=-5, f(-2)=-5, f(-1)=-5, f(0)=-5, f(1)=-5,f(2)=-5, f(3)=-5\) points on the graph are \[(-3,-5),(-2,-5),(-1,-5),(0,-5),...\]
\[1a. f(x) = x^2 + 3; x = -3, -2, -1, 0, 1, 2, 3 \] \[f(-3)=(-3)^2+3=9+3=12\] \[f(-2)=(-2)^2=4+3=7\] \[f(-1)=(-1)^2=1+3=4\] etc etc
just sub in values and see the value of the function and graph |dw:1372124262418:dw|
